Who are we?

Breedr launched its Precision Livestock Management app in 2019 and is on the mission to empower farmers, processors and food retailers with tools to produce transparency, traceability, environmentally and commercially sustainable meat, safeguarding the future of their business and plant. It now supports over 2.8 million cattle from 6,500 farms across the UK, EU, US, Australia and New Zealand. We are constantly developing a suite of tools which will help farmers, ranchers and supply chains make better informed decisions improving animal management and animal health to deliver a production base fit for the future.

What You'll Be Doing

As our US Marketing Manager, you will be the engine room of Breedr’s US marketing and the person who makes things happen day to day. Reporting to the Head of Growth and Marketing, you will own our website, our marketing data and systems, and the delivery of our campaigns and events.

You will be senior and organised enough to keep the US team moving when the Head of Growth and Marketing is travelling or working UK hours. This role is based in our Austin office.

Key Responsibilities

  • Deliver marketing projects and campaigns, coordinating the team, agencies and freelancers.
  • Help develop the messaging and customer stories that resonate with ranchers, working with the content and product teams.
  • Own the website, keep content current and accurate, and manage the third parties who build and update it.
  • Own our marketing analytics, connect the trail from advert to sign-up to subscription, keep the data clean, and report on what is working.
  • Manage the events calendar and logistics end to end, and track what each event costs and returns.
  • Work closely with the sales and account-management teams so they have what they need to succeed.
  • Act as the local point of coordination for the US marketing team.

About You

  • Three or more years in a marketing role, with a track record of getting things delivered.
  • Genuinely comfortable with HubSpot (or a similar CRM), marketing analytics and reporting
  • A strong project manager who can run several things at once and keep events and campaigns on track.
  • Organised, calm under pressure, and able to prioritise.
  • A great communicator who works well with sales, product and outside agencies.
  • A self-starter who can work independently and use data to make decisions.
  • Experience or interest in ranching, cattle or agriculture.
